Peelable heat shrink tubing offers numerous advantages in various applications. This specialized tubing is designed for temporary use and can be effortlessly removed after application. It provides excellent insulation and protection early in a project while allowing easy access to connections when needed.
In electrical work, peelable heat shrink tubing serves as a reliable solution. It seals wires from moisture and contaminants, enhancing durability. When repairs or modifications are necessary, the tubing can be quickly peeled away without causing damage. This efficiency saves time and resources, accelerating project timelines.
Moreover, using peelable heat shrink tubing promotes a neat appearance in finished products. The smooth surface reduces the risk of snagging or tearing. However, some users have reported challenges in matching the right size. Ensuring a proper fit is crucial to maintain its protective qualities. Attention to detail during installation can mitigate these issues, leading to more successful outcomes.
Peelable heat shrink tubing offers significant durability and protection for various applications. Its unique design allows for easy removal, which can be beneficial in many projects. According to recent industry reports, this type of tubing can withstand extreme temperatures ranging from -55°C to 125°C. This flexibility ensures that components remain safe under harsh conditions.
In addition to thermal resistance, peelable heat shrink tubing is resistant to moisture and chemicals. This resistance helps protect electrical connections, extending the lifespan of the components. An evaluation from a leading materials science study indicates that incorporating these tubes can enhance protection by 50% when exposed to solvents and abrasives. Such enhancement translates into lower maintenance costs and reduces downtime.
